I found a few helpful items:
I got some free test strips from this volunteer organization a while back (if you have a few $$ rattling around looking for a home, they can always use donations.)
Diabetes Angel Network

(They are always a little bit behind, so it could take several months depending on donations.)
Lilly Cares Program... apparently, if your Dr. fills out a form, you are eligible for free insulin. I have not tried this one.

LIfescan (makers of test strips and meters)
I have not tried this one either... I am told that you may be able to call their customer service line and let them know you are low income. They might cut loose with some free strips. 800 227-8862
(Every once in a while they will run a promo with big chain pharmacies and offer a free meter when you buy a big box of strips at regular price.)
